Abstract: A PLANE MIRROR ILLUMINATION SYSTEM FOR ILLUMINATING A DOCUMENT PLANE OF A DOCUMENT COPYING MACHINE IN SUCH A MANNER THAT THE LIGHT INTENSITY AT ANY POINT OF THE DOCUMENT PLANE VARIES INVERSELY TO THE RELATIONSHIP KNOWN AS THE COSINE FOURTH POWER LAW. THIS COMPENSATES FOR THE ATTENUATION OF LIGHT BY THE FOCUSING LENS ACCORDING TO THE COSINE FOURTH POWER LAW AND PROVIDES A UNIFORM ILLUMINATION LEVEL ON THE IMAGE PLANE.

Abstract: A magnetic card transport which includes three drive rollers. A forward drive roller for driving the magnetic card toward the entry throat for recording character by character and for ejecting the card from the transport; a reverse drive roller for positioning the card in an opposite direction for read checking a previously recorded character; and a high speed reverse drive roller for positioning the card at the beginning of a track during initial entry from the throat and from the end of a previously recorded track. The three drive rollers continuously rotate beneath the card and the card is caused to move by application of a pinch roller to the card to press it into rolling contact with its associated drive roller. A fixed guide rail is provided and the card is biased against the fixed guide rail by means of guide springs. Further, to prevent misalignment of the card during reading and writing the pinch rollers associated with the forward and reverse drive rollers are canted such that the resultant moments of force are in a direction to bias the card against the fixed drive rail. The entry/exit throat of the card transport, the drive rollers and the magnetic head are located such that optimum utilization of the recording area on the card is accomplished. In addition, a dual card switch located near the innermost extremity of the card bed is positioned such that it is not contracted during normal movement of the card, but in the event an operator attempts to insert another card and thereby force the original card further into the machine and out from under the pinch rollers, the switch is operative to signal the logic that an eject cycle must be entered into and the mechanical spring of the switch causes the card which tripped the switch to be flipped back into engagement with the drive rollers such that that card is also ejected.

Abstract: APPARATUS FOR RECORDING INFORMATION ON A RECORDING SURFACE The start of each cycle of a pump, which supplies a pressurized ink stream through a nozzle for application to a recording surface on a rotary drum, is synchronized with each revolution of the drum. If more than one cycle of the pump occurs during each revolution of the drum, the number of the cycles in each drum revolution must be an integer with each cycle starting an equal angle of the revolution of the drum from the start of the prior cycle.

Abstract: An ink jet printing apparatus is described having facilities for printing information in character locations, (boxes) each character location comprising a plurality of vertical columns of drop locations, and a number of characters comprising a line of information. Structures and circuits are included for insuring correct location of information within the character boxes and also providing for one mode in which characters are printed continuously line-by-line and another mode in which characters are printed incrementally character-by-character. During incremental printing, as well as the first character in a line or group of characters, provision is made for re-bounding the printhead back into the box of the character just printed, that is, prior to the next character box to be printed to insure that when the printhead starts up again for the next character that all drop components for that character, including any located in the immediate vicinity of the character boundary, are properly placed during printing.

Abstract: FACSIMILE MID-PAGE RESTART The method and apparatus shown herein provide for restarting a facsimile operation after a mid-page interrupt without overlapping or splitting the image. Furthermore, this is accomplished in a facsimile system that does not have a one-to-one synchronous relationship between synchronized mechanisms in the system. In operation, a print carriage is synchronized to a false once-around signal related to the motion of a print drum. There is a predetermined cyclic relationship between the false oncearound and the real once-around for the drum. If a mid-page interrupt occurs, the line position at the time of interrupt is remembered, and the particular relationship existing between the false once-around and the real once-around at the time of interrupt is remembered. The carriage is backed up to a point prior to the mid-page interrupt and rests until restart. Upon restart, the carriage is accelerated up to speed and resynchronized to the false oncearound before it reaches the point of interrupt. The once-around to which the carriage is resynchronized has the same relationship to the real oncearound as stored at the time of interrupt. When the carriage reaches the interrupt point, that position is detected, and the facsimile system resumes printing on the next line without splitting or overlapping the image.
